Tacubaya vs Summerside, Pe Climate & Distance Between

Canada flag
  • The distance between Tacubaya, Mexico and Summerside, Pe, Canada is approximately 4,400 km or 2,734 mi.
  • To reach Tacubaya in this distance one would set out from Summerside, Pe bearing 239°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Tacubaya bearing 218.7° or SW .
  • Tacubaya has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Summerside, Pe has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Tacubaya is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Summerside, Pe is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 10.5 °C (18.9°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 21.4 °C (38.5°F) less in Tacubaya.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 212.6 mm (8.4 in) less which is equivalent to 212.6 l/m² (5.22 US gal/ft²) or 2,126,000 l/ha (227,284 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 25.9° higher in Tacubaya than in Summerside, Pe.
